Working on a 72 Olds Cutlass W-30. They have stripes that go from the front bumper to the rear bumper and around the wheelwells. I went ahead and painted the body and doors, shooting 3 coats of universal clear. My plan is to paint the fenders off the car, again using 3 coats of clear. Basically, getting the whole car green. Then doing final assembly of the car, sanding the clear with 800, spraying the stripes, and then clearing the whole car again with 3 more coats.
Is this a solid plan? The body and doors will probably have to sit all winter before I can get back on it to spray the stripes. Should I wait until i'm ready to spray the stripes to sand the car with 800? After spraying the stripes, should I spray a light coat (or 2) of clear just on the stripe area (after the stripes are sprayed), as kind of a tack coat, first to avoid the dreaded horizontal runs that can come? Owner wants the stripes buried under the clear.
